    Global Benefits Specialist

    Location:
    Remote USA or UKOur client's platform enables people to build healthy and equitable relationships, through its online App's.

    The business delivers a holistic benefit and wellbeing programs supporting its diverse, global population, creating, and fostering an environment where all employees and their families thrive.

    The company operates in over fifteen countries around the world, and benefits are a critical element to its competitive offering in many locations.

    As part of the Global Total Rewards function you will be responsible for administration and compliance of benefit programs primarily in the United States but expanding into the global portfolio over time.

    You will work with the Director, Global Benefits to deliver the strategic vision of global benefits.

    This role will assist in planning for all programs (Health & Welfare, Risk, Retirement and perquisites) in the benefits portfolio and your role is vital in helping us create a positive employee experience.


    What you'll do:
    Administer employee benefit programs, ensuring compliance with company policies and regulatory requirements.
    Process and manage employee benefit enrolments, changes, and terminations in Workday ensuring vendors receive accurate enrolment and eligibility information.
    Facilitate new employee benefits orientation, distribute all communication materials, determine eligibility, and provide guidance on available benefit options. You'll also conduct periodic training sessions for employees and HR staff on benefits-related topics.
    Monitor and audit benefit data to ensure accuracy and resolve discrepancies in both in-house systems and vendor portals.

    Conduct regular benefit plan audits to ensure compliance with legal and company requirements and work with auditors to gather necessary information.

    Respond to employee inquiries regarding benefits, eligibility, and coverage, providing clear and helpful information; assist employees with benefit claims issues as needed serving as a liaison between employees and insurance providers.

    Enrol employees with carriers and process life status changes.
    Respond to benefits inquiries from managers and employees on plan provisions, benefits enrolments, status changes and other general inquiries.

    Process and administer all leave-of-absence requests and disability paperwork: medical, personal, disability and FMLA and effectively interpret FMLA and ADA implications as they relate to leaves of absences/disabilities.

    Respond to 401(k) inquiries from managers and employees relating to enrolments, plan changes and contribution amounts. Manage the annual catch-up contribution enrolment.

    Assists in the development and implementation of benefit policies and procedures and coordinate and participate in benefits-related projects, such as plan design changes or system upgrades.

    Administer the tuition reimbursement program.
    Partner with team members to support Global well-being programs.
